- Abstract
- Colour scheme for a single-light stained glass window featuring the Descent of the Holy Ghost upon the Virgin Mary and the Disciples, with angels at the base and the Holy Spirit on top. Part of the Glorious mysteries of the Rosary for St. Malachy’s College in Belfast.By Richard King.Signatures/ Inscriptions: Bottom, in faded pencil: ‘Descent of the Holy ghost’; bottom right hand side: ‘Clarke Dublin.’
